Essential Considerations for a River Rafting Camping Excursion

Effective planning and preparation are paramount for a safe and enjoyable experience. Adherence to the following guidelines will mitigate potential risks and enhance the overall quality of the expedition.

Tip 1: Prioritize Safety Gear: Mandatory equipment includes a properly fitted personal flotation device (PFD) for each participant. Helmets are strongly recommended, particularly for sections of the river with rapids rated Class III or higher. Maintain a comprehensive first-aid kit with supplies appropriate for injuries common in outdoor environments.

Tip 2: Plan the Route Meticulously: Research river conditions, including water levels, rapids classifications, and potential hazards such as submerged obstacles. Obtain accurate maps and charts of the waterway and surrounding terrain. Share the itinerary with a responsible contact person who can initiate emergency procedures if necessary.

Tip 3: Secure Necessary Permits and Permissions: Many waterways require permits for both rafting and camping. Contact the relevant land management agencies (e.g., National Park Service, Bureau of Land Management) well in advance to secure the appropriate documentation. Be aware of any restrictions regarding camping locations or campfire regulations.

Tip 4: Practice Leave No Trace Principles: Pack out all trash and waste materials. Minimize campfire impact by using established fire rings or portable stoves. Avoid disturbing vegetation or wildlife. Dispose of human waste properly by utilizing designated latrines or digging cat holes at least 200 feet from water sources and campsites.

Tip 5: Prepare for Variable Weather Conditions: Mountainous regions are subject to sudden and unpredictable weather changes. Pack layers of clothing appropriate for a range of temperatures and precipitation. Include waterproof gear to protect against rain and spray. Monitor weather forecasts regularly and be prepared to adjust the itinerary if necessary.

Tip 6: Select Campsites Strategically: Choose locations that are above the high-water mark, away from potential hazards such as falling rocks or unstable slopes, and with minimal impact on the surrounding environment. Prioritize established campsites whenever possible. Ensure adequate space for tents and cooking areas.

Tip 7: Master Essential Rafting Skills: Participants should possess proficiency in basic paddling techniques, including forward strokes, backstrokes, and maneuvering around obstacles. If navigating challenging rapids, consider engaging the services of a qualified river guide. Practice self-rescue techniques, such as flipping and re-entering the raft.

1. Safety Protocols Adhered

1. Safety Protocols Adhered, River

The successful and responsible execution of river rafting camping hinges significantly on the strict adherence to established safety protocols. These protocols are not merely suggestions but rather critical guidelines designed to mitigate inherent risks associated with navigating waterways and residing in wilderness environments. A comprehensive understanding and implementation of these measures are paramount for preventing accidents and ensuring participant well-being.

  • Personal Flotation Device (PFD) Utilization

    The consistent and correct use of a properly fitted PFD is the single most crucial safety measure in any river-based activity. A PFD provides buoyancy in the event of accidental immersion, increasing the chances of survival in fast-moving water. For example, a sudden capsize in a rapid necessitates immediate flotation to prevent drowning. The implications of neglecting this protocol are severe, as demonstrated by numerous incidents where the absence of a PFD has resulted in fatalities.

  • Comprehensive Pre-Trip Briefing

    Prior to embarking on the expedition, all participants must receive a thorough briefing covering potential hazards, emergency procedures, and communication protocols. This includes instruction on identifying and avoiding obstacles, understanding river signals, and knowing how to respond to various scenarios, such as a swimmer in distress. A well-informed team is better equipped to anticipate and manage unforeseen challenges. Failure to provide adequate briefing can lead to panic and disorganization in emergency situations, compounding the risks.

  • Rafting Equipment Inspection and Maintenance

    Regular inspection and maintenance of all rafting equipment are essential for ensuring its functionality and preventing failures. This includes checking for leaks, tears, and wear on the raft itself, as well as verifying the integrity of paddles, ropes, and other essential gear. For instance, a punctured raft in a remote location can create a serious emergency. Diligent equipment maintenance minimizes the likelihood of such incidents and contributes to a safer overall experience.

  • River Hazard Awareness and Avoidance

    Identifying and avoiding river hazards, such as strainers (downed trees or debris partially submerged in the water), undercuts, and rapids exceeding skill levels, is crucial for preventing accidents. Pre-scouting the river and understanding its characteristics are vital steps in this process. For example, attempting to navigate a Class IV rapid without the necessary experience can result in serious injury or even death. Prudent judgment and respect for the river’s power are essential components of safety protocol adherence.

2. Equipment Suitability Checked

2. Equipment Suitability Checked, River

The assessment of equipment suitability constitutes a cornerstone of safe and successful river rafting camping endeavors. Selecting and verifying the appropriateness of all gear directly impacts the comfort, safety, and overall outcome of the expedition. A failure to address equipment needs adequately can result in discomfort, inefficiency, or, in severe cases, life-threatening situations.

  • Raft Integrity and Capacity

    The river raft serves as the primary vessel and must be rigorously evaluated for structural integrity. This includes inspecting the material for punctures, abrasions, or weakened seams. Furthermore, the raft’s stated weight capacity must not be exceeded, considering the combined weight of participants, gear, and provisions. An overloaded or compromised raft increases the risk of instability, capsizing, or equipment failure, especially in turbulent waters. For example, a raft designed for Class II rapids may be unsuitable for a Class IV river section, demanding a more robust and appropriately sized vessel.

  • Personal Protective Gear Assessment

    Personal protective gear, including personal flotation devices (PFDs) and helmets, require careful inspection to ensure proper fit and functionality. PFDs must be the correct size for each individual and in serviceable condition, free from tears or compromised straps. Helmets should fit securely and offer adequate protection against impacts. Defective or ill-fitting protective gear offers limited or no protection in the event of an accident. An example would be a helmet with a cracked shell offering inadequate protection from head injuries sustained during a capsize.

  • Campsite Gear Functionality

    Campsite gear, encompassing tents, sleeping bags, cooking stoves, and lighting devices, necessitates pre-trip testing to verify proper operation. Tents should be inspected for waterproof integrity and structural stability. Sleeping bags must provide adequate insulation for anticipated nighttime temperatures. Cooking stoves require functionality checks to ensure efficient and safe operation. Malfunctioning campsite gear can lead to discomfort, exposure, and potential health risks. A tent with a compromised rainfly, for instance, will fail to protect occupants from inclement weather.

  • Navigation and Communication Tools Verification

    Navigation and communication tools, such as maps, compasses, GPS devices, and satellite communication devices, must be thoroughly tested and verified to ensure accurate functionality. Batteries should be fresh, and devices should be waterproofed or stored in waterproof containers. Reliance on malfunctioning navigational or communication equipment can lead to disorientation, delays, and potential emergencies. A GPS device with outdated maps, for instance, may provide inaccurate location information, leading to navigational errors.

3. Campsite Selection Strategic

3. Campsite Selection Strategic, River

Strategic campsite selection constitutes a pivotal element within the broader context of river rafting camping. This process transcends the mere identification of a flat surface and involves a meticulous evaluation of factors that directly influence safety, environmental impact, and overall comfort. The repercussions of inadequate site selection can range from minor inconveniences to severe safety hazards, underscoring the critical importance of careful planning.

The interplay between river rafting and campsite location manifests through several key considerations. First, accessibility by raft is paramount; the chosen site must be easily reachable from the waterway, facilitating the efficient loading and unloading of equipment. Second, the site’s elevation relative to the river level is crucial, mitigating the risk of flooding due to fluctuating water levels. For instance, a campsite situated on a low-lying sandbar is susceptible to inundation during periods of heavy rainfall or dam releases, potentially jeopardizing equipment and necessitating emergency evacuation. Third, the topography of the site influences stability and comfort; steep slopes or uneven terrain can compromise the structural integrity of tents and create uncomfortable sleeping conditions. Finally, proximity to natural hazards, such as unstable cliffs or areas prone to landslides, necessitates a wide safety margin. Example: Selecting a campsite 30 meters from a cliff edge after a rain storm, increase risk of debris falling.

4. Environmental Impact Minimized

4. Environmental Impact Minimized, River

The responsible practice of river rafting camping necessitates a proactive approach to minimizing environmental impact. The inherent nature of this activity, involving travel through and overnight stays in natural areas, presents potential risks to sensitive ecosystems. Therefore, a commitment to minimizing disturbances and preserving the integrity of the environment is paramount.

  • Waste Management and Removal

    Effective waste management involves meticulous packing out of all trash, food scraps, and other refuse generated during the expedition. This includes adhering to the principle of “pack it in, pack it out” and avoiding the burning or burying of waste, which can contaminate soil and water sources. For example, improperly disposed food scraps can attract wildlife, disrupting natural feeding patterns and potentially creating dependence on human-provided food. The consequences of negligent waste management include pollution, habitat degradation, and the introduction of invasive species.

  • Water Source Protection

    Protecting water sources from contamination requires avoiding washing activities, dishwashing, or waste disposal within a specified distance (typically 200 feet) of rivers, streams, and lakes. The use of biodegradable soaps and detergents is recommended, and wastewater should be dispersed widely away from water bodies. For example, soap residue can alter the pH balance of water, harming aquatic organisms and impacting water quality. Neglecting water source protection can lead to the spread of waterborne illnesses and the degradation of aquatic ecosystems.

  • Campsite Selection and Management

    Strategic campsite selection involves choosing established campsites or areas with durable surfaces to minimize vegetation trampling and soil compaction. Avoid disturbing vegetation unnecessarily, and prioritize the use of existing fire rings or portable stoves to minimize campfire impact. Campsites should be left in a condition cleaner than they were found, free from trash, debris, and signs of human presence. For instance, repeated use of the same campsite can lead to soil erosion and the loss of native plant species. Responsible campsite management helps preserve the natural integrity of the area.

  • Wildlife Interaction and Habitat Preservation

    Minimizing wildlife interaction involves maintaining a respectful distance from animals, avoiding feeding them, and storing food securely to prevent access. Disturbing wildlife habitats, such as nesting sites or breeding grounds, should be avoided. For example, approaching a nesting bird too closely can cause it to abandon its nest, leading to the death of its offspring. Responsible wildlife interaction and habitat preservation are essential for maintaining biodiversity and ensuring the long-term health of ecosystems.

5. Weather preparedness paramount

5. Weather Preparedness Paramount, River

Weather preparedness is of utmost importance within river rafting camping, extending beyond a mere consideration to become a fundamental aspect of trip planning and execution. Given the inherent exposure to natural elements and the potential for rapid weather changes in riverine and mountainous environments, rigorous preparation is non-negotiable for ensuring participant safety and minimizing risks associated with adverse weather conditions.

  • Layered Clothing Systems

    The implementation of a layered clothing system is essential for adapting to fluctuating temperatures and precipitation levels. This involves wearing multiple layers of clothing that can be added or removed as needed to regulate body temperature. For example, a base layer of moisture-wicking fabric, an insulating mid-layer, and a waterproof outer layer can provide adequate protection against a wide range of weather conditions. Neglecting to utilize a layered system can lead to hypothermia or overheating, both of which pose significant risks to physical well-being.

  • Waterproof Gear and Equipment Protection

    Waterproof gear is essential for protecting both individuals and equipment from rain, spray, and accidental submersion. This includes waterproof jackets, pants, boots, and dry bags for storing sensitive items such as electronics, clothing, and sleeping bags. For instance, a dry bag can prevent a sleeping bag from becoming soaked in the event of a raft capsize, preventing hypothermia. Failure to utilize waterproof gear can result in discomfort, equipment damage, and increased risk of hypothermia.

  • Weather Forecasting and Monitoring

    Continuous monitoring of weather forecasts before and during the trip is crucial for anticipating potential weather changes and making informed decisions about route planning, campsite selection, and activity modifications. Utilizing reliable weather sources and carrying a weather radio can provide timely warnings of approaching storms or other hazardous weather conditions. For example, an approaching thunderstorm may necessitate postponing a rafting trip or seeking shelter in a protected location. Ignoring weather forecasts can lead to unexpected exposure to dangerous conditions and increased risks of accidents.

  • Emergency Shelter and Contingency Planning

    Having access to emergency shelter and a comprehensive contingency plan is essential for mitigating the impacts of unexpected weather events. This includes carrying a lightweight tarp or emergency blanket for temporary shelter, as well as having a backup plan for alternative routes or evacuation options in case of severe weather. For instance, a designated emergency campsite with pre-stashed supplies can provide a safe haven in the event of a sudden storm. Lacking emergency shelter and a contingency plan can leave participants vulnerable to the elements and significantly increase the risk of adverse outcomes.

Frequently Asked Questions Regarding River Rafting Camping

The following section addresses common inquiries and misconceptions surrounding river rafting camping. The responses provided aim to offer clear, factual information to promote safe and responsible participation in this outdoor activity.

Question 1: What is the recommended age range for participation in river rafting camping?

The suitability of river rafting camping is determined by several factors, including physical fitness, swimming ability, and experience level. While there is no universally defined age range, participants should possess sufficient strength and stamina to paddle for extended periods and navigate river currents. Children should be accompanied by experienced adults and possess a demonstrable ability to follow instructions and respond appropriately in emergency situations.

Question 2: What level of rafting experience is required to undertake a river rafting camping trip?

The required experience level depends on the specific river and the rapids classification. Class I and II rapids are generally considered suitable for beginners, while Class III and higher require advanced skills and knowledge. It is strongly recommended that inexperienced individuals participate in guided trips or receive formal instruction before attempting self-guided expeditions. An assessment of personal skills and the river’s difficulty is crucial.

Question 3: What are the essential safety precautions for river rafting camping?

Essential safety precautions include wearing a properly fitted personal flotation device (PFD) at all times, utilizing helmets in areas with rapids, carrying a comprehensive first-aid kit, informing someone of the itinerary, and being aware of weather conditions. Furthermore, participants should be proficient in self-rescue techniques and understand river signals. Avoidance of alcohol or drug consumption during the activity is also critical.

Question 4: What types of campsites are suitable for river rafting camping?

Suitable campsites are located above the high-water mark, away from unstable slopes or falling rocks, and preferably on established sites to minimize environmental impact. Campsites should offer sufficient space for tents and cooking areas, and be located at a reasonable distance from water sources to prevent contamination. Prioritization should be given to sites that minimize disturbance to vegetation and wildlife.

Question 5: How should human waste be managed during a river rafting camping trip?

Proper management of human waste is essential for protecting water quality and preventing the spread of disease. Utilize designated latrines if available. If latrines are not available, dig a cat hole at least 200 feet (60 meters) from water sources and campsites. Bury waste and toilet paper completely. Pack out toilet paper if burying is not feasible.

Question 6: What are the recommended strategies for minimizing environmental impact during river rafting camping?

Strategies for minimizing environmental impact include packing out all trash, using biodegradable soaps, avoiding disturbing vegetation or wildlife, minimizing campfire use, and adhering to Leave No Trace principles. Respect for the environment is paramount, and participants should strive to leave the area cleaner than they found it.
